☐ Locker assignment — grab the new starter a locker in the Birchway changing rooms before they arrive; the good ones near the showers go fast. Mid-row lockers are fine too, just avoid the bottom row by the dryer vent (trust me). Pop their name card in the slot and log the locker number with facilities. The changing-room door is keypad-only until their badge activates, so give them the code below.

staff pass of kawip-hawef = bdg-QLP-2

**Mgmt Meeting Minutes — Retiring the Brightline Range**

Quick recap for sales leads at Fenholt Supplies: we agreed to retire the Brightline fixture range by year-end. Remaining stock moves to clearance pricing next month, and accounts on standing orders get migrated to the Lumetta range. Trade-in incentives were approved in principle. The confidential note on next steps sits just below.

board note of bajof-bajeg: The pricing group signed off on a budget of $13.4 million for Project Sildor. The renewal with Lamixek Holdings closes at $48.9 million a year, 49 percent above the last contract.

## Runbook: GraphQL N+1 fix rollout (Fennimore API)

This week we ship the dataloader batching fix that eliminates the N+1 pattern on the `orders.lineItems` resolver. Expect query volume to the Fennimore read replicas to drop roughly 70%. Rollout is canary-first: 5% for two hours, then full fleet if p95 latency holds. Artifacts are already built; the release bundle must be signed before promotion using the key below.

release key, tajep-tahaf: bky19_d9NV5NtNvNNQVVKBK4P

### Runbook: Account Recovery During Zero-Downtime Migrations

Release manager notes for Harborline. If an operator account is locked mid-migration, do not roll back — the expand-contract sequence tolerates recovery safely. Confirm the dual-write phase is active, verify backfill lag is under five minutes, then restore the account via the migration-safe admin path, which skips the legacy auth table. That admin path prompts once, and it accepts the recovery passphrase given below.

vault phrase of bagaf-kajeg = jorath-feniel-briir-siliel-ralix